Preparation

1

Thoroughly pat the tofu dry with paper towels and cut into bite-sized cubes. Wash the pak choi, quarter the leaves lengthwise, and rinse the mung bean sprouts in cold water.

2

Finely chop the ginger and garlic. Lightly bruise the lemongrass stalk with the back of a knife so that the essential oils can fully release.

Preparing the soup

1

Heat 1 tbsp of vegetable oil in a pan. Fry the tofu cubes all over for approx. 6 to 8 minutes until golden brown and crispy, then set aside.

Chef's tip

For an even richer flavor, you can stir a teaspoon of peanut butter or light miso directly into the broth.

If you like it extra zesty, squeeze a little fresh lime juice directly over the tofu before your first spoonful.
